A compassionate, shame-free guide for your darkest days “A one-of-a-kind book . . . to read for yourself or give to a struggling friend or loved one without the fear that depression and suicidal thoughts will be minimized, medicalized or over-spiritualized.”—Kay Warren, cofounder of Saddleback Church What happens when loving Jesus doesn’t cure you of depression, anxiety, or suicidal thoughts? You might be crushed by shame over your mental illness, only to be told by well-meaning Christians to “choose joy” and “pray more.” So you beg God to take away the pain, but nothing eases the ache inside. As darkness lingers and color drains from your world, you’re left wondering if God has abandoned you. You just want a way out. But there’s hope. In I Love Jesus, But I Want to Die, Sarah J. Robinson offers a healthy, practical, and shame-free guide for Christians struggling with mental illness. With unflinching honesty, Sarah shares her story of battling depression and fighting to stay alive despite toxic theology that made her afraid to seek help outside the church. Pairing her own story with scriptural insights, mental health research, and simple practices, Sarah helps you reconnect with the God who is present in our deepest anguish and discover that you are worth everything it takes to get better. Beautifully written and full of hard-won wisdom, I Love Jesus, But I Want to Die offers a path toward a rich, hope-filled life in Christ, even when healing doesn’t look like what you expect.

Morris White escaped the crime and working-class roots in the Philly projects by learning to cook. He’s got great taste and impeccable kitchen skills, and now he’s a Sous Chef at a first-rate Philadelphia French bistro. The stove burners aren’t the only thing that’s on fire in Morris’s life, since his affair with Vicky Ward has just heated up. She’s the manager at the bistro and comes from money and a privileged background. Together, they’re dreaming of opening their own restaurant, where she’ll run the front-of-the-house business and he’ll run the kitchen. But their dream gets sidetracked when Morris takes in his half-brother, Vince Kammer, who’s just been released from prison. Vince did time for a jewelry store robbery that went sideways, and the local mob boss who bankrolled the crime, Johnny “Stacks” Staccardo, is insisting that Vince pull another job to make up for the loss of the jewels he never received. Johnny Stacks has his gangster wannabe henchmen, Lenny and Mo, riding Vince pretty hard, and to make matters worse, Dick Franks, the corrupt cop who originally investigated the jewelry store heist, has gotten wind that Vince is out of the can. Franks believes Vince has the missing diamonds, and there’s not much that Franks won’t do to get his hands on those stones. When Morris discovers Vince’s predicament, he has to summon the inner tough guy from his youth (and dig up a gun he had hidden away), to keep Vince from doing anything stupid. Caught between the gangsters, the vicious Dick Franks, and Vince’s own desire for revenge, Morris risks losing his new love, his dreams, even his life in order to save Vince from himself. In a world of hyper-productivity, a modern division of classes emerges between the gifted and the blanks—the haves and the have-nots. As a scientist at the prestigious Vision Office, the life of Vincent Turner takes a thrilling turn when he joins the research project on a former blank who has somehow acquired a gift. The project disrupts the carefully-maintained social order of the world, and presents the country an opportunity to make everyone truly equal. Richly thought-provoking and meticulously crafted, Giftless offers an honest confrontation with the future that has been long overdue.
